Our August Party is a great time to see some of the brighter summer objects toward the core of our Milky Way Galaxy! And the Perseid Meteors may still be streaking across the sky in the later hours of the night.
Our society volunteers will be on site with their scopes for you to come view the heavens. Whether your looking for a fun date night, are curious about what's "up there," or are unsure about getting your own scope, this is the event for you.
You're welcome to bring your own telescope or binoculars- just follow the parking staff directions to place you in the planned setup area.
